Are you talking combo hunt or one of the two? If you're talking both Montana is a good destination because they sell combo tags.

If you're talking one or the other I'd decide on a primary and secondary target... is the focus gonna be elk or mule deer? That'll help narrow down areas.

I'd look at draw entry deadlines for Montana, Colorado, and Wyoming so you can plan to have choices narrowed in time. They're right around the corner for the first and last I don't know about Colorado.

Colorado is a place you can get OTC elk tags. Montana & Wyoming are draw, but the former is easier to get a general tag and you can hunt designated wilderness areas without a guide unlike Wyoming.
